National Youth Jazz Ensemble @ The Sugar Club, Dublin

Jazz Poster-page-001

A new Dublin-based big-bang jazz ensemble formed last month, the National Youth Jazz Ensemble play their first ever show at Dublin’s Sugar Club on Monday, August 10.

Bringing together some of Ireland’s finest jazz musicians, the project – “aimed at those in the midst of, or who have completed third level education” – hopes to provide a platform through whcih young musicians can excel.

With a repertoire comprising of early swing, modern big band chats and every other conceivable sub-genre of jazz, the performance is set to feature the likes of the Irish premiere of Duke Ellington’s Nutcracker Suite and Bob Curnow’s arrangements of pieces by Pat Metheny and Lyle Mays as played by the LA Big Band.
